Why choose a pod system?

Pod systems are designed for simplicity. They typically combine a small battery unit with replaceable or prefilled pods, removing the need for manual coil changes, complex settings or bulky tanks. Benefits include:

  • Portability: Most pod kits are pocket-friendly and lightweight.
  • Ease of use: Snap-in pods or prefilled cartridges make refilling and setup straightforward.
  • Discreetness: Lower vapour output and compact size suit public use and on-the-go vaping.
  • Consistency: Prefilled options often deliver consistent flavour and nicotine delivery.

Key features to consider

Battery life and charging
A compact device must still offer enough battery to last a typical day. Look for clear battery indicators and fast charging support if you’re frequently out and about. Devices marketed as “pod kits” vary widely in capacity, so match the mAh rating to your daily use.

Pod compatibility and options
Consider whether the kit uses prefilled pods or refillable pods. Prefilled pod kits are ultra-convenient and reduce mess, while refillable pods give you greater freedom to experiment with e-liquids. Many kits, including the IVG Nexio Kit, offer both prefilled and refillable solutions across their range.

Coil performance and airflow
Although pods use small coils, quality of the coil affects flavour and throat hit. Adjustable airflow is a bonus on pod systems, letting you tailor draw resistance from a tight MTL (mouth-to-lung) hit to a slightly airier inhale. Pod kits that strike the right balance will satisfy former smokers looking for a realistic throat sensation without overwhelming vapour.

Flavour and nicotine delivery
If you prioritise flavour, choose a system known for preserving e-liquid nuances. Prefilled pod kits often come with professionally blended e-liquids formulated to work well with the device’s coil resistance and power. The IVG Nexio Prefilled Pod Kit, for example, pairs pods specifically tuned to the battery output for consistent taste.

Build quality and ergonomics
Comfortable design matters — a device should feel good in the hand and be easy to operate with one button or draw activation. Durable materials and good pod retention (how firmly the pod stays seated) reduce leaks and improve user experience.

Maintenance and getting the best from your kit

Replace pods in good time
Prefilled and refillable pods will degrade with use. Replace them when flavour diminishes or you notice reduced vapour. Using IVG Nexio Pods (whether prefilled or refillable options compatible with the range) helps maintain consistent taste and coil performance.

Keep contacts clean
Wipe the battery and pod contacts occasionally to ensure a snug electrical connection and prevent intermittent firing.

Store e-liquids properly
If using refillable pods, store e-liquids upright in a cool, dark place to prolong flavour and nicotine stability.

Avoid chain vaping
Even compact kits have thermal limits. Allow short pauses between draws to prevent burnt taste and extend coil life.

Comparing prefilled vs refillable pod kits

Prefilled pod kits

  • Pros: Convenience, mess-free, consistent flavour, no need to buy bottles of e-liquid.
  • Cons: Limited flavour options per pack, recurring cost of replacing pods.

Refillable pod kits

  • Pros: Greater variety of e-liquids, cost-effective long term, more control over nicotine strength.
  • Cons: Slightly more maintenance, potential for spills if not careful.

Which is right for you depends on lifestyle and taste. Many vapers find a prefilled pod kit ideal for travel, while a refillable pod kit suits those who like experimenting with flavours at home.
